#299679 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#299679 is composed of 16.1% red, 58.8% green and 47.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 72.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 19.3% yellow and 41.2% black. It has a hue angle of 164 degrees, a saturation of 57.1% and a lightness of 37.5%. #299679 color hex could be obtained by blending #52fff2 with #002d00. Closest websafe color is: #339966.

#299679 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#299679 has RGB values of R:41, G:150, B:121 and CMYK values of C:0.73, M:0, Y:0.19, K:0.41. Its decimal value is 2725497.
